About The Role:
- Assess patients' physical abilities, medical history, and limitations
- Develop and implement personalized treatment plans
- Administer therapeutic exercises and manual therapy
- Monitor and document progress, adjusting plans as needed
- Collaborate with healthcare professionals for coordinated care
- Advise on mobility aids and assistive devices
- Promote health, wellness, and mobility through education and support
Qualifications
- Qualified Occupational Therapist (OT)
- Current AHPRA registration
- First Aid & CPR certification
- Australian National Police check
- Professional Indemnity Insurance
- Experience in community care assessment and planning
- Valid Driver's License and reliable vehicle
